WebJan 9, 2024 · The top three Indian states based on bajra output have three more fascinating states to look at. In Tamil Nadu, Pearl Millet was grown on 58,000 hectares and produced 177,000 metric tonnes in 2014-15. Cuddalore, Virudhunagar, Thiruvannamalai, Thoothukudi, Villupuram, and Vellore are the districts with the greatest output.
